Agasmar
Agasmar is a village located in Kharsia tehsil of Raigarh district in Chhattisgarh, India. It is situated 13km away from sub-district headquarter Kharsia (tehsildar office) and 53km away from district headquarter Raigarh. As per 2009 stats, Chhotepandarmuda is the gram panchayat of Agasmar village.

About Agasmar
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Agasmar is 435170. The village spans a total geographical area of 163.15 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 496665. Kharsia is nearest town to Agasmar village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 14km away.
When it comes to local governance, Agasmar village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Kharsia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Raigarh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Agasmar
According to the 2011 Census, Agasmar has a total population of about 389, with approximately 194 males and 195 females. The sex ratio is around 1005 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 55 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 7 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 365. The overall literacy rate is approximately 78.15%, with male literacy at about 83.51% and female literacy near 72.82%. There are around 93 households in the village.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 389 | 194 | 195 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 55 | 30 | 25 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 7 | 5 | 2 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 365 | 179 | 186 |
Literate Population | 304 | 162 | 142 |
Illiterate Population | 85 | 32 | 53 |
Connectivity of Agasmar
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Agasmar. As per the 2011 stats, Agasmar had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available |
Private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
